The NEW 12000 Smoke/CO Combo Combination
Smoke/Carbon Monoxide Alarms provide a single installation and
double the protection. Two Deadly Threats
Fire and Carbon Monoxide (CO) represent two of the major threats to
the health and lives of homeowners and their families. Fire and smoke
are often visible, providing occupants with a warning of their
presence. CO on the other hand, issues no warning signs. It is
odorless and can build up very slowly over time. Often families become
sick without even knowing the cause.
Firex Advantage
Firex ® 12000 combination alarms monitor both smoke and CO emissions.
Electrical contractors can easily satisfy most building requirements
for fire and CO protection with a single unit, reducing installation
costs. Smart Interconnect Wiring allows the Firex
12000 to be connected to additional smoke alarms and CO alarms on a
single interconnect wire eliminating the need for additional wiring
and providing whole-house protection.

Omegaflex Bulletin
Omegaflex has discontinued its TracPipe Yellow CSST gas pipe in the United States. When our inventory is depleted we will be offering TracPipe CounterStrike product. The fittings and fastening system remain the same for both products.
